Learn more Community Expert , /t5/after-effects-discussions/good-particle-effect-plugin/m-p/12900418#M198977 Apr 24, 2022 Apr 24, 2022 Copy link to clipboard Copied In Response To Indie767 You can generate a dust cloud in AE very effectively using several techniques. Fractal Noise and a distorted track matte with some blur and some blend modes can create a very realistic dust cloud. For larger dust particles you'll need to use some particle system, but realism is going to require more than one layer with particle effects and the use of blend modes and probably track mattes. If we saw the scene you are trying to create we could give you some better suggestions. Learn more Community Expert , /t5/after-effects-discussions/good-particle-effect-plugin/m-p/12899755#M198949 Apr 23, 2022 Apr 23, 2022 Copy link to clipboard Copied In Response To Indie767 If using the stand-alone version of BorisFX Particle Illusion, you'll have to render your particle animation and then import that into After Effects.Per the user documentation, "ProRes is the preferred format, as it’s the only way to embed an alpha channel into the video — select one of the ProRes Presets that contain alpha. (With MP4 you must render the RGB and Alpha as two separate files.)" ( option to consider that I don't think has been mentioned yet is stock footage of dust. It's pretty easy to find clips that are free ( as well as those that have a fee and then layer that in with a Blending Mode or Magic Bullet Universe Unmult ( That effect knocks out black.
